## Further Reading

Sweepling is the data-retention sweeper for the Corvax platform. It deletes expired records nightly per tenant policy. Support should not re-run sweeps manually; escalate to the Retention squad instead. Common tickets: records deleted earlier than expected (check tenant policy overrides) and sweeps skipped (check the pause flag). Logs are retained for 30 days. Policy definitions, escalation paths, and the tenant override matrix are documented on the internal page linked below.

wiki page, yaguf-bawig: https://jira.norvacorp.internal/browse/display/view/b5a061abb09d

**Q: The Queuemont autoscaler stopped scaling even though queue depth is climbing — what now?**

First check whether the scaler is in "hold" state; it pauses itself after three failed scale-up attempts. Clear the hold from the operator panel and verify worker quotas in the Bramfield cluster. If the panel itself is locked out, use the emergency unlock, which requires the recovery passphrase recorded below.

unlock words, fafop-hawep: briwyn-oliix-sorox

Q: The Grellometer sidecar is reporting gaps in aggregated metrics — what should I check first?

A: Gaps usually mean the sidecar's flush buffer overflowed, not that the upstream service stopped emitting. Confirm the pod's memory headroom, then check the drop counter on the sidecar itself. Restarting clears the buffer but loses in-flight samples, so only restart after capturing diagnostics. The full triage sequence, including buffer sizing guidance, is documented on the internal page below.

wiki page, tahaf-tajog: https://jira.ordindyn.corp/pipeline

**Vendor note: Inkmill markdown pipeline**

Rendering for Parchway docs is outsourced to Inkmill under an annual contract, renewing each March. They handle sanitization and PDF export; we own the upload queue. SLA: 4-hour response on rendering failures. Escalate only after two failed retries. Their support desk is reachable at the address below.

billing contact of hahaf-baguf = zorael.tammir.jorius@sivrelhq.internal

Subject: Quickstore 4.2 — bloom filter now fronts the KV layer

Plugin authors: starting with this release, Quickstore places a bloom filter ahead of the key-value store. Negative lookups return faster; false positives fall through safely. No API changes are required on your side. Verify your plugin against the staging build referenced below.

session token of fahif-tadup = htk3_9c7